## Authentication

The Resolvia diagnostics tool probes our flaky DNS resolution issue by querying the Nameplane internal service directly, bypassing the local resolver cache. All probe requests must be authenticated, or Nameplane silently drops them, which can be mistaken for another resolution failure. Reviewers running the integration suite should export the credential shown below before starting a probe session.

API key for yahig-tadup: kto7_ubizbYm

## Auditlog Viewer — Data Stores

The Trellick audit-log viewer reads from a dedicated replica, never the primary. Retention is 90 days; older rows roll into cold storage nightly via the Ferndale job. Queries are read-only and capped at 10k rows per request. Schema changes must be flagged in the weekly sync before merge, since the viewer pins column names. For local debugging against the staging replica, use the connection string below.

replica DSN, kajep-yahag: mssql://praok_svc:iF@db-8d68.plorvaio.local:5432/eliion

## CSV Import Wizard — On-Call Notes

The Parloft import wizard handles bulk CSV uploads for the Greymarsh tenant portal. If an import stalls past twenty minutes, check the staging queue before restarting the worker — half-processed batches must be flushed first or rows duplicate. Manual reprocessing requires you to re-sign the import manifest so the validator accepts it downstream. Keep the retry count under three; beyond that, escalate to the data team. The manifest signing key you'll need is listed below.

signing key of bagap-yawep = bky13_TbfT6ZMUoGJo2

Facilities Ticket — Cleaning Crew Access, Brindle Annex

For new starters handling evening lock-up: the Sorano Cleaning crew arrives nightly at 21:30 via the annex side door. Check their rota sheet, note arrival in the log, and ensure the storeroom is relocked afterward. To let them through the side door, enter the access code below.

badge for yaweg-hafog: bdg-GX-6